Core Syllabus Pillars
Resources – Types & Conservation: Introduction to what constitutes a resource, and the vital distinction between natural, human-made, and human resources.
Land, Soil, Water, and Wildlife: A deep dive into the degradation and conservation of our most critical life-support systems, including natural vegetation and wildlife resources.
Agriculture & Farming Systems: Understanding different types of farming—from subsistence to commercial cultivation—and major crop patterns globally and across India.
Industries & Manufacturing: Exploring how raw materials are transformed into valuable products, focusing on the distribution of iron, steel, and information technology hubs.
Human Resources: Analyzing population distribution, density, growth, and the factors that influence population change across the globe.
